The People Score for the Lung Cancer Score in 38563, Gordonsville, Tennessee is 45 when comparing 34,000 ZIP Codes in the United States.
An estimate of 90.45 percent of the residents in 38563 has some form of health insurance. 31.13 percent of the residents have some type of public health insurance like Medicare, Medicaid, Veterans Affairs (VA), or TRICARE. About 68.34 percent of the residents have private health insurance, either through their employer or direct purchase.
A resident in 38563 would have to travel an average of 5.98 miles to reach the nearest hospital with an emergency room, Riverview Regional Medical Center. In a 20-mile radius, there are 31 healthcare providers accessible to residents living in 38563, Gordonsville, Tennessee.
